Players

List of hundreds
Player
HS
Runs scored in an inns
Mins
Balls
4s
6s
SR
Team
Opposition
Ground
Match Date
Scorecard
100*10027218411254.34KZ-Natalv W ProvinceDurban2 Oct 2014First-class
11511519815619173.71E. Provincev GautengJohannesburg2 Oct 2014First-class
124124161115201107.82Griq Westv KZN-InlandKimberley2 Oct 2014First-class
10810821315615269.23E. Provincev GautengJohannesburg2 Oct 2014First-class
101101-2379-42.61W Provincev NamibiaWindhoek9 Oct 2014First-class
202*202-29420368.70W Provincev NamibiaWindhoek9 Oct 2014First-class
16716732420926-79.90E. Provincev BorderGqeberha9 Oct 2014First-class
103*103-24313142.38Namibiav W ProvinceWindhoek9 Oct 2014First-class
148148-19717475.12E. Provincev NamibiaWindhoek16 Oct 2014First-class
10510526921616-48.61Gautengv North WestPotchefstroom16 Oct 2014First-class
10210221414417-70.83Gautengv North WestPotchefstroom16 Oct 2014First-class
104*10440028811136.11KZ-Natalv NorthernsCenturion16 Oct 2014First-class
10910918212312188.61Free Statev Griq WestKimberley16 Oct 2014First-class
11211215815513272.25Gautengv North WestPotchefstroom16 Oct 2014First-class
126*12644429816-42.28KZN-Inlandv Free StatePietermaritzburg23 Oct 2014First-class
120*12038828318142.40W Provincev S West DOudtshoorn23 Oct 2014First-class
116116-20918-55.50Namibiav North WestWindhoek23 Oct 2014First-class
166*166-25718264.59North Westv NamibiaWindhoek23 Oct 2014First-class
10910920916017168.12S West Dv W ProvinceOudtshoorn23 Oct 2014First-class
14414427318020280.00Easternsv BolandBenoni23 Oct 2014First-class
135*13531820820264.90KZ-Natalv E. ProvinceDurban30 Oct 2014First-class
11811830525117-47.01Free Statev NorthernsBloemfontein30 Oct 2014First-class
133*13338525920-51.35Bolandv W ProvincePaarl30 Oct 2014First-class
107*107-22412-47.76E. Provincev EasternsGqeberha6 Nov 2014First-class
16116138930118-53.48Borderv Griq WestEast London13 Nov 2014First-class
13713728922315-61.43Borderv Griq WestEast London13 Nov 2014First-class
14214233524720-57.48Bolandv North WestPotchefstroom13 Nov 2014First-class
134*13425217920174.86North Westv KZ-NatalPotchefstroom20 Nov 2014First-class
14214222317420281.60Free Statev GautengBloemfontein20 Nov 2014First-class
15615634423614-66.10Gautengv BorderJohannesburg27 Nov 2014First-class
10810833423121-46.75Borderv GautengJohannesburg27 Nov 2014First-class
138*13823516312784.66S West Dv EasternsBenoni27 Nov 2014First-class
18218244935923250.69W Provincev EasternsCape Town4 Dec 2014First-class
108108-1488172.97KZN-Inlandv NamibiaWindhoek4 Dec 2014First-class
150150194147216102.04Easternsv W ProvinceCape Town4 Dec 2014First-class
104*10413687132119.54W Provincev EasternsCape Town4 Dec 2014First-class
201*2012311831212109.83S West Dv BolandPaarl11 Dec 2014First-class
163*16339428115258.00Free Statev NamibiaBloemfontein11 Dec 2014First-class
13713725919718-69.54Griq Westv BolandKimberley18 Dec 2014First-class
100*10019715512364.51North Westv NorthernsPotchefstroom18 Dec 2014First-class
17617633422122579.63North Westv Griq WestKimberley8 Jan 2015First-class
116*11622518710562.03Easternsv NorthernsBenoni8 Jan 2015First-class
12212222714117186.52E. Provincev KZN-InlandGqeberha8 Jan 2015First-class
107*10728016513164.84Free Statev KZ-NatalDurban15 Jan 2015First-class
10410424518115257.45KZN-Inlandv EasternsPietermaritzburg15 Jan 2015First-class
10310324918212156.59Easternsv KZN-InlandPietermaritzburg15 Jan 2015First-class
150*150211148126101.35Northernsv Griq WestCenturion15 Jan 2015First-class
133*13346731315-42.49Easternsv Free StateBenoni22 Jan 2015First-class
10010029720810-48.07Gautengv BolandPaarl22 Jan 2015First-class
141*14131021426-65.88North Westv S West DPotchefstroom22 Jan 2015First-class
103*10319412911-79.84W Provincev Griq WestCape Town22 Jan 2015First-class
20420439030424167.10S West Dv North WestPotchefstroom22 Jan 2015First-class
114*11419614419279.16Griq Westv W ProvinceCape Town22 Jan 2015First-class
11711726019816159.09KZ-Natalv Griq WestDurban29 Jan 2015First-class
14414421314516399.31E. Provincev Free StateBloemfontein29 Jan 2015First-class
10310321415811365.18Free Statev E. ProvinceBloemfontein29 Jan 2015First-class
15715736523521266.80North Westv E. ProvinceGqeberha12 Feb 2015First-class
10110119912114-83.47Borderv W ProvinceCape Town12 Feb 2015First-class
13013018713914293.52Northernsv NamibiaPretoria12 Feb 2015First-class
1111111239987112.12North Westv E. ProvinceGqeberha12 Feb 2015First-class
2012012001431513140.55Northernsv NamibiaPretoria12 Feb 2015First-class
104*10418214411672.22Borderv W ProvinceCape Town12 Feb 2015First-class
128*12827621416259.81W Provincev KZN-InlandCape Town19 Feb 2015First-class
23523534925030494.00Northernsv E. ProvinceCenturion19 Feb 2015First-class
10210218811216-91.07Free Statev BorderBloemfontein19 Feb 2015First-class
107*10732822020-48.63KZ-Natalv S West DOudtshoorn19 Feb 2015First-class
10110114911815185.59E. Provincev NorthernsCenturion19 Feb 2015First-class
Adjust:Most recentPast weekPast MonthPast year4 years10 years25 years
Performances in matches that overlap decades are credited to the year in which they occurred - this results in some unknown data, especially in regard to bowling figures
Performances in matches that overlap years are credited to the year in which they occurred - this results in some unknown data, especially in regard to bowling figures
Records includes the following current or recent matches:

Pakistan Television vs State Bank of Pakistan at Karachi, President's Trophy Grade-I 4th Match, Dec 28-31, 2025 [First-class]

Sui Northern Gas Pipelines Limited vs Sahir Associates at Karachi, President's Trophy Grade-I 1st Match, Dec 28-30, 2025 [First-class]

Oil & Gas Development Company Limited vs Ghani Glass at Karachi, President's Trophy Grade-I 3rd Match, Dec 28-30, 2025 [First-class]